India is the birthplace of several major world religions, including Hinduism, Buddhism, Jainism, and Sikhism. Spirituality is an integral part of Indian culture, with many Indians practicing some form of meditation, yoga, or other spiritual disciplines. The concept of "Dharma" (duty) and "Karma" (action) are fundamental to Indian philosophy, emphasizing the importance of living a virtuous life and fulfilling one's responsibilities.

Indian culture and lifestyle represent a dynamic synthesis of ancient traditions and modern aspirations. While regional and socioeconomic diversities create varied lived experiences, common threads of family, spirituality, hospitality, and celebration persist. Understanding this complexity is essential for anyone engaging with India—socially, academically, or professionally.
